At the heart of Dr.Piagets theories was an orderly schedule of stages, of childrens perceptions by age.翻译:The unique contribution of the United States to those who love the great outdoors are the National Parks and State Parks. They are beautifully organized and give particular thought to campers. There are also campsites by the sea, which are hidden from the beach by a lion of sand dunes, or a thick belt of trees. Wherever you go, you can nearly always find picnic places complete with wooden tables, benches, garbage cans and restrooms.美国为野外活动爱好者所做的特殊贡献是建立了众多的国家公园和州立公园,这些公园布局漂亮,体现了对野营爱好者的特殊关爱。海边也有许多野营营地。这些营地,或在海滩一连串的沙丘后,或在海滩茂密的林带后面。无论你走到哪里,几乎总能找到地方野餐,这些地方设备齐全,全都配有木制桌子、凳子、垃圾桶和洗手间。世界上很少有国家能像美国这样有如此多样诱人的野外旅游资源。美国气候多样,风景秀丽,公路四通八达,人们可以驱车前往任何值得观光的地方。许多美国人,无论老幼,都喜欢开野营车外出野营。有些老年退休夫妇将他们很大一部分的储蓄存款用来购买这种“车上家园”。他们每年花半年时间漫游美国,享受野外的绚丽风光。Few countries have such a varied and tempting Outdoors as the USA.
